Azra Ghani is a British epidemiologist at Imperial College London.

- One remaining uncertainty is how severe the disease caused by the omicron variant is compared to disease caused by previous variants. Whilst it may take several weeks to fully understand this, governments will need to put in place plans now to mitigate any potential impact. Our results demonstrate the importance of delivering booster doses as part of the wider public health response.
- Azra Ghani (2021) cited in "Does the COVID-19 booster shot stop omicron? Here’s what a new study says" on Deseret News, 17 December 2021.
